Aerogel-loaded foam concrete filled composite thermal insulation building block and preparation method thereof
The invention provides an aerogel-loaded foam concrete filled composite thermal insulation building block and a preparation method thereof. The composite thermal insulation building block comprises aconcrete hollow building block, an aerogel-loaded foam concrete block body and a foam concrete binder layer, wherein the concrete hollow building block comprises a closed bottom surface and a side surface perpendicular to the bottom surface; the bottom surface and the side surface form a cavity; the cavity is filled with the aerogel-loaded foam concrete block body; the bottom surface of the aerogel-loaded foam concrete block body is propped against the bottom surface of the concrete hollow building block; a gap is reserved between the side surface of the aerogel-loaded foam concrete block bodyand the side surface of the concrete hollow building block; the height of the aerogel-loaded foam concrete block body is lower than the depth of the cavity; the gap is filled with the foam concrete binder layer; and the top surface of the aerogel-loaded foam concrete block body is covered with the foam concrete binder layer. The invention aims to provide the composite thermal insulation buildingblock with the compressive strength of 3.5Mpa or above and the heat conductivity coefficient of 0.20W/(m.k) or below and how to obtain the composite thermal insulation building block, so that the composite thermal insulation building block is more practical.
